1The heavens declare the glory of God; And the firmament showeth his handiwork.

2Day unto day uttereth speech, And night unto night showeth knowledge.

3There is no speech nor language; Their voice is not heard.

4Their line is gone out through all the earth, And their words to the end of the world. In them hath he set a tabernacle for the sun,

5Which is as a bridegroom coming out of his chamber, And rejoiceth as a strong man to run his course.
